Test A: Anti-Lock Brake Control Module Does Not Respond To NGS Tester

NOTE: If repairs to a module communication network circuit is required, see REPAIRING BUS WIRING  . If module replacement is necessary, see PROGRAMMING  and REMOVAL & INSTALLATION  .
  1. Turn ignition switch to OFF position. Inspect Data Link Connector (DLC) for damage. Repair as necessary. Disconnect anti-lock brake control module 25-pin harness connector C111. Inspect connector for damage. Repair as necessary. Connect anti-lock brake control module harness connector C111. Connect NGS tester to DLC. Turn ignition switch to ON position. Perform data link diagnostic test. See DATA LINK DIAGNOSTIC TEST  under SELF-DIAGNOSTIC SYSTEM. If result was ABS: NO RESPONSE ON CKT914 (BUS+), go to next step. If result was ABS: NO RESPONSE ON CKT915 (BUS-), go to step  5 .
  2. Turn ignition switch to OFF position. Disconnect NGS tester. Disconnect anti-lock brake control module 25-pin harness connector C111. Measure resistance between anti-lock brake control module harness connector C111 terminal No. 15 (Tan/Orange wire) and DLC terminal No. 2 (Tan/Orange wire). If resistance is 5 ohms or more, go to next step. If resistance is less than 5 ohms, replace anti-lock brake control module.
  3. Disconnect in-line 16-pin harness connector C292. Inspect connector for damage. Repair as necessary. Measure resistance between male half of in-line harness connector C292 terminal No. 4 (Tan/Orange wire) and DLC terminal No. 2 (Tan/Orange wire). If resistance is less than 5 ohms, go to next step. If resistance is 5 ohms or more, repair open in Tan/Orange wire between in-line harness connector C292 and DLC.
  4. Disconnect in-line 16-pin harness connector C180. Inspect connector for damage. Repair as necessary. Measure resistance between female half of in-line harness connector C292 terminal No. 4 (Tan/Orange wire) and male half of in-line harness connector C180 terminal No. 4 (Tan/Orange wire). If resistance is less than 5 ohms, repair open in Tan/Orange wire between of in-line harness connector C180 and anti-lock brake control module. If resistance is 5 ohms or more, repair open in Tan/Orange wire between in-line harness connector C292 and in-line harness connector C180.
  5. Turn ignition switch to OFF position. Disconnect NGS tester. Disconnect anti-lock brake control module 25-pin harness connector C111. Measure resistance between anti-lock brake control module harness connector C111 terminal No. 6 (Pink/Light Blue wire) and DLC terminal No. 10 (Pink/Light Blue wire). If resistance is 5 ohms or more, go to next step. If resistance is less than 5 ohms, replace anti-lock brake control module.
  6. Disconnect in-line 16-pin harness connector C292. Inspect connector for damage. Repair as necessary. Measure resistance between male half of in-line harness connector C292 terminal No. 2 (Pink/Light Blue wire) and DLC terminal No. 10 (Pink/Light Blue wire). If resistance is less than 5 ohms, go to next step. If resistance is 5 ohms or more, repair open in Pink/Light Blue wire between in-line harness connector C292 and DLC.
  7. Disconnect in-line 16-pin harness connector C180. Inspect connector for damage. Repair as necessary. Measure resistance between female half of in-line harness connector C292 terminal No. 2 (Pink/Light Blue wire) and male half of in-line harness connector C180 terminal No. 6 (Pink/Light Blue wire). If resistance is less than 5 ohms, repair open in Pink/Light Blue wire between in-line harness connector C180 and anti-lock brake control module. If resistance is 5 ohms or more, repair open in Pink/Light Blue wire between in-line harness connector C292 and in-line harness connector C180.
